Offer description

If you are looking for a career with a company that invests in its people, we have just the opportunity for you! All you need is a full UK driving licence and your most recent CV.As an Estate Agent at Haybrook Estate Agents in Swinton, you will receive:£25,000 OTE per yearUncapped commissionCompany Car (Full UK Driving Licence required)Full-time working hours: 8:30am to 6pm, four weekdays per week, and 9am to 5pm every SaturdayYour additional benefits as an Estate Agent at Haybrook Estate Agents in Swinton include:30 days annual leave (including bank holidays )Enrolment at the Spicerhaart Learning & Development CentreOngoing training and development opportunities within your roleFully-funded training course to achieve a nationally recognised property industry qualificationCareer progression opportunities, including at least one promotion within your first 12 monthsEmployee Assistance Programme (24/7 confidential helpline)Eye care Employee Referral BonusCompany Pension SchemePersonal 'Talk Time' with our CEOsOpportunity to join the CEO Exclusive Achievers ClubChance to qualify for our annual Spicerhaart Incentive TripEligibility for the annual black-tie Elevate Awards in relevant categoriesYour journey as an Estate Agent begins with one week at the Spicerhaart Learning & Development Centre:Purpose-built training locationIndustry-leading training through one-to-one and group sessionsDaily learning sessions led by industry expertsFully-paid hotel accommodation during training in Colchester Breakfast, lunch, and dinner provided during your stay How you will make an impact as an Estate Agent at Haybrook Estate Agents in Swinton:Market properties to potential tenants or homeownersArrange and conduct property viewingsNegotiate offersGenerate new leads via canvassing, door knocking, leaflet dropping, and moreBuild and maintain strong client relationshipsContinue your training and development with support from your mentorThe characteristics that will make you a successful Estate Agent include:PassionAmbitionDriveStrong work ethicPositive mindsetSolution-oriented approachGood communication skillsPeople skillsCustomer-focused attitudeRespectfulnessApply now!Terms & Conditions apply Full UK Driving Licence must be for a manual carNote: If you are successful in your application but voluntarily leave within the first 12 months, you may be required to reimburse the company for training costs.Armed Forces Covenant: Spicerhaart is a forces-friendly company supporting those transitioning from the armed forces.If you seek an exciting career where your communication skills are vital daily, consider a role in property sales and lettings.For more information, visit:
